/* Elements */
body	{
	background:#69c6c9;
	font-family:"Trebuchet MS", Verdana, Tahoma, Arial, sans-serif;
	text-decoration:none;
	}
	
ul {
	list-style:none;
	}
	
h1 {
	font-family:Arial, Helvetica, sans-serif;
	font-size:26px;
	color:#69c6c9;
	text-transform:uppercase;
	margin-left:20px;
	margin-bottom:0px;
	z-index:5;
	}
	
h2	{
	font-family:Arial, Helvetica, sans-serif;
	font-size:22px;
	color:#232e31;
	text-transform:uppercase;
	margin-left:20px;
	z-index:5;
	}
	
a	{
	text-decoration:none;
	color:#232e31;
	font-weight:bold;
	}
	
table {
	width:836px;
	}
	
td	{
	width:209px;
	height:12px;
	padding-left:20px;
	}
	
/*  This is the CSS for the images  */	
#logo	{
	position:absolute;
	width:244px;
	height:151px;
	background:url(images/logo.png) no-repeat;
	top:24px;
	left:36px;
	text-indent:-9999em;
	margin:0;
	z-index:3;
	}

#splashpic	{
	position:absolute;
	width:954px;
	height:431px;
	background:url(images/splash11.jpg) no-repeat; 
	top:198px;
	left:36px;
	text-indent:-9999em;
	margin:0;
	
	}
	
#image-left	{
	position:absolute;
	width:327px;
	height:431px;
	background:url(images/image-left.png) no-repeat;
	top:198px;
	left:36px;
	margin:0;
	z-index:3;
	}
	
#image-left-white {
	position:absolute;
	width:327px;
	height:431px;
	background:#FFFFFF;
	top:198px;
	left:36px;
	margin:0;
	z-index:3;
	}
	
#image-right {
	position:absolute;
	width:627px;
	height:431px;
	background:url(images/image-right.png) no-repeat;
	top:198px;
	left:363px;
	margin:0;
	z-index:3;
	}
	
#image-right-white {
	position:absolute;
	width:627px;
	height:431px;
	background:#FFFFFF;
	top:198px;
	left:363px;
	margin:0;
	z-index:3;
	}
	
	
#image-right-white-exhibitor {
	position:absolute;
	width:836px;
	height:431px;
	background:#FFFFFF;
	top:198px;
	left:363px;
	margin:0;
	z-index:3;
	}
	
#image-right-white-exhibitor-2 {
	position:absolute;
	width:836px;
	height:491px;
	background:#FFFFFF;
	top:198px;
	left:363px;
	margin:0;
	z-index:3;
	}
	
#image-right-about {
	position:absolute;
	width:627px;
	height:431px;
	background:url(images/about.jpg) no-repeat;
	top:198px;
	left:363px;
	margin:0;
	z-index:3;
	}

#image-right-contact {
	position:absolute;
	width:627px;
	height:431px;
	top:198px;
	left:363px;
	margin:0;
	z-index:3;
	}

#image-right-gala {
	position:absolute;
	width:627px;
	height:431px;
	top:198px;
	left:363px;
	margin:0;
	z-index:3;
	}
	
#image-right-press {
	position:absolute;
	width:627px;
	height:431px;
	top:198px;
	left:363px;
	margin:0;
	z-index:3;
	}
	
#image-right-show {
	position:absolute;
	width:627px;
	height:431px;
	top:198px;
	left:363px;
	margin:0;
	z-index:3;
	}
	
#image-right-sponsors {
	position:absolute;
	width:627px;
	height:431px;
	top:198px;
	left:363px;
	margin:0;
	z-index:3;
	}
	
#image-right-lectures {
	position:absolute;
	width:627px;
	height:431px;
	top:198px;
	left:363px;
	margin:0;
	z-index:3;
	}
	
#image-right-exhibitors {
	position:absolute;
	width:627px;
	height:431px;
	top:198px;
	left:363px;
	margin:0;
	z-index:3;
	}
	
#image-left-about	{
	position:absolute;
	width:327px;
	height:431px;
	top:198px;
	left:36px;
	margin:0;
	z-index:3;
	}

#image-left-exhibitors	{
	position:absolute;
	width:327px;
	height:431px;
	top:198px;
	left:36px;
	margin:0;
	z-index:3;
	}
	
#image-left-exhibitors-2	{
	position:absolute;
	width:327px;
	height:491px;
	background:url(images/exhibitors2a.jpg) no-repeat;
	top:198px;
	left:36px;
	margin:0;
	z-index:3;
	}
	
#image-left-lectures	{
	position:absolute;
	width:327px;
	height:431px;
	background:url(images/lecturesleft.jpg) no-repeat;
	top:198px;
	left:36px;
	margin:0;
	z-index:3;
	}

#image-left-lectures-2	{
	position:absolute;
	width:327px;
	height:431px;
	background:url(images/lectures2left.png) no-repeat;
	top:198px;
	left:36px;
	margin:0;
	z-index:3;
	}
	
#image-left-lectures-3	{
	position:absolute;
	width:327px;
	height:431px;
	background:url(images/lectures3left.jpg) no-repeat;
	top:198px;
	left:36px;
	margin:0;
	z-index:3;
	}

	
/* End CSS for images */

/* This is the CSS for Text Styling */

#left-block-text {
	position:absolute;
	display:block;
	top:198px;
	left:0px;
	height:431px;
	width:267px;
	margin:10px;
	padding-left:30px;
	padding-right:30px;
	z-index:10;
	}
	
#left-block-text p {
	position:absolute;
	display:block;
	font-size:12px;
	color:#232e31;
	left:0px;
	width:275px;
	height:431px;
	margin-left:53px;
	margin-right:45px;
	z-index:10;
	text-align:justify;
	}
	
#right-block-text {
	position:absolute;
	display:block;
	top:198px;
	left:363px;
	width:627px;
	height:431px;
	margin-left:0;
	margin-right:0;
	z-index:10;
	}
	
#right-block-text p {
	position:absolute;
	display:block;
	font-size:12px;
	color:#232e31;
	left:0px;
	width:587px;
	height:431px;
	margin-left:20px;
	margin-right:20px;
	z-index:10;
	text-align:justify;
	}
	
/* This is the Navigation Menu CSS */

#nav  {
	position:relative;
	width:577px;
	height:13px;
	background:url(images/nav_menu_new.png);
	top:155px;
	left:380px;
	margin:0;
	padding:0;
	}
	
#nav li {
	float:left;
	}
	
#nav li a {
	position:absolute;
	top:0;
	margin:0;
	padding:0;
	display:block;
	height:13px;
	background:url(images/nav_menu_new.png) no-repeat;
	text-indent:-9999px;
	overflow:hidden;
	font-size:1%;
	text-decoration:none;
	}
	
li#nav_show a {
	left:0;
	width:53px;
	background-position: 0 0;
	}
	
li#nav_gala a {
	left:53px;
	width:52px;
	background-position:-53px 0;
	}
	
li#nav_about a {
	left:105px;
	width:65px;
	background-position:-105px 0;
	}
	
li#nav_lectures a {
	left:170px;
	width:88px;
	background-position:-170px 0;
	}
	
li#nav_exhibitors a {
	left:258px;
	width:97px;
	background-position:-258px 0;
	}
	
li#nav_sponsors a {
	left:355px;
	width:92px;
	background-position:-355px 0;
	}

li#nav_press a {
	left:446px;
	width:61px;
	background-position:-446px 0;
	}
	
li#nav_contact a {
	left:508px;
	width:69px;
	background-position:-508px 0;
	}

li#nav_show a:hover {
	background-position:0 -13px;
	}	

li#nav_gala a:hover {
	background-position:-53px -13px;
	}
	
li#nav_about a:hover {
	background-position:-105px -13px;
	}
	
li#nav_lectures a:hover {
	background-position:-170px -13px;
	}
	
li#nav_exhibitors a:hover {
	background-position:-258px -13px;
	}
	
li#nav_sponsors a:hover {
	background-position:-355px -13px;
	}

li#nav_press a:hover {
	background-position:-446px -13px;
	}
	
li#nav_contact a:hover {
	background-position:-508px -13px;
	}
	
#body_show li#nav_show a {
	background-position:0 -26px;
	}

#body_gala li#nav_gala a {
	background-position:-53px -26px;
	}
	
#body_about li#nav_about a {
	background-position:-105px -26px;
	}
	
#body_lectures li#nav_lectures a {
	background-position:-170px -26px;
	}
	
#body_exhibitors li#nav_exhibitors a {
	background-position:-258px -26px;
	}
	
#body_sponsors li#nav_sponsors a {
	background-position:-355px -26px;
	}

#body_press li#nav_press a {
	background-position:-446px -26px;
	}
	
#body_contact li#nav_contact a {
	background-position:-508px -26px;
	}

/* End Navigation CSS */	

/* Begin Footers */

/* This is the LEFT Footer */

#footer1 {
	position:relative;
	top:633px;
	left:36px;
	width:67px;
	height:13px;
	background:url(images/contact-menu.png);
	margin:0;
	padding:0;
	z-index:10;
	}
	
#footer1 li {
	float:left;
	}

#footer1 li a	{
	position:absolute;
	top:0;
	margin:0;
	padding:0;
	display:block;
	height:13px;
	background:url(images/contact-menu.png) no-repeat;
	text-indent:-9999px;
	overflow:hidden;
	font-size:1%;
	}

li#footer1_contact a {
	left:0;
	width:67px;
	background-position:0 0;
	}
	
li#footer1_contact a:hover {
	background-position:0 -13px;
	}	
	
#body_contact li#footer1_contact a {
	background-position:0 -13px;
	}

/* This is the right footer */

#footer2	{
	position:absolute;
	color:#232e31;
	text-decoration:none;
	font-size:x-small;
	top:658px;
	left:380px;
	z-index:10;
	}
	
#footer2 a {
	color:#232e31;
	text-decoration:none;
	font-size:x-small
	}
	
/* These are the LEFT and RIGHT Footers for the Exhibitor Page ONLY!!*/

#footer1-exhibitor {
	position:relative;
	top:680px;
	left:36px;
	width:67px;
	height:13px;
	background:url(images/contact-menu.png);
	margin:0;
	padding:0;
	z-index:10;
	}
	
#footer1-exhibitor li {
	float:left;
	}

#footer1-exhibitor li a	{
	position:absolute;
	top:0;
	margin:0;
	padding:0;
	display:block;
	height:13px;
	background:url(images/contact-menu.png) no-repeat;
	text-indent:-9999px;
	overflow:hidden;
	font-size:1%;
	}

#footer2-exhibitor	{
	position:absolute;
	color:#232e31;
	text-decoration:none;
	font-size:x-small;
	top:695px;
	left:380px;
	z-index:10;
	}
	
#footer2-exhibitor a {
	color:#232e31;
	text-decoration:none;
	font-size:x-small
	}
	
/* Text Desgn & Table Design */

.toprow	{
	margin-top:20px;
	}

.exhibitor	{
	font-family:Arial, Helvetica, sans-serif;
	font-size:x-small;
	}
	
.small {
	font-family:Arial, Helvetica, sans-serif;
	font-size:small;
	}
